PUBLIC NOTICE OF ELECTION
and REFERENDUM 2026
THE FIRE COMMISSIONERS OF
FIRE DISTRICT #3
UPPER TOWNSHIP,
COUNTY OF CAPE MAY, NEW JERSEY
Notice is hereby given to the legal voters of Fire District #3, in Upper Township, County of Cape May, that an election for the naming of Two (2) Commissioners for the Fire Commissioners of Fire District #3, in Upper Township, County of Cape May, will be held at the Marmora Fire House, 40 N. Old Tuckahoe Road, Marmora, New Jersey.
Date of Election: February 21, 2026
Time of Election: 2:00 p.m. to 9:00 p.m.
Voters will also be asked to vote YES or NO on the approval of the budget for the Fire Commissioners of Fire District #3, in Upper Township, County of Cape May, for the fiscal year 2026, which budget proposes an amount of $821,434.58 to be raised by taxation.
Voters will also be asked to vote YES or NO on the referendum approving the Fire Commissioners of Fire District #3, Upper Township, Cape May County, be authorized to purchase one (1) new fire apparatus, including all necessary equipment and accessories, at a total cost not to exceed Three Million Dollars ($3,000,000), and to finance such purchase by the issuance of bonds or notes (see N.J.S.A. 40A:2-1 et seq.), by lease-purchase or installment purchase agreement(s), by the use of available capital reserve funds, or by any combination thereof, as permitted by law.
Approval of this question will authorize the Fire Commissioners of Fire District #3, Upper Township, Cape May County, to acquire one (1) new tower ladder fire apparatus, together with all necessary equipment and accessories, to be used for fire protection and emergency response services within the Fire District.
The tower ladder fire apparatus will provide firefighters with the ability to safely access roofs, upper stories, and elevated areas of buildings from the ladder itself, reducing exposure to hazardous conditions and enhancing firefighter safety. The apparatus will support firefighting, rescue, ventilation, and other emergency operations from a secure and controlled platform.
The purchase is intended to replace the Fire District’s existing ladder apparatus, which is approaching the end of its useful service life. Replacement parts have become increasingly difficult to obtain, maintenance costs are expected to increase, and reliability may decline over time.
The total cost of the apparatus, including all related equipment and expenses, shall not exceed Three Million Dollars ($3,000,000). The Board of Fire Commissioners may finance the purchase through one or more methods permitted by law, including bonds or notes, lease-purchase or installment agreements, capital reserve funds, or any combination thereof. Approval of this question does not obligate the Fire District to use all authorized financing methods or to borrow the full authorized amount.
A “NO” vote means the Board will not be authorized to purchase the apparatus or appropriate funds for that purpose.
Only registered voters residing within Fire District #3 may vote in this election.
